$QCOM 24 hours dropped 6.65%, now priced at 229.42. In the Trump trading framework, this is no longer just about the chip cycle; it's about policy expectations being repriced. The last time the White House hinted at tightening restrictions on certain countries' semiconductors, Qualcomm reversed its gains from the earnings report in just two days. I felt at the time that the volatility of this asset was underestimated, as the new administration's stance towards China is more unpredictable than the previous one, with over sixty percent of Qualcomm's revenue tied there. Funding is currently 0, with both longs and shorts not paying fees; this position is quite delicate. Generally, after a significant drop, if the market is uniformly bearish, the rates can turn negative, meaning shorts would need to pay longs. But thatโ€™s not happening here, indicating that the panic hasnโ€™t spilled over into a liquidation event. Open Interest (OI) is still hanging around 40.5 million, suggesting that capital hasnโ€™t withdrawn and someone is picking up chips near the limit down. I feel the current structure is like waiting for the wind; itโ€™s not like the wind has already stopped. From my trading diary, during Trumpโ€™s previous term when Huawei was placed on the Entity List, QCOM fell from 90 to 58 over three weeks and then took four months to recover. If export controls really escalate this time, the impact on authorized income will be greater than last time because Qualcomm's market share in the Android camp is not comparable to that of 2019. But conversely, if itโ€™s just hot air without any action, this emotional sell-off is basically free money. The market is trading an ambiguous risk, with no one knowing the specifics; better to run first and ask questions later. My current thinking is as follows: if the 230 level holds for three days without breaking, I will open a small position, keeping my exposure within 2% of total capital, with a stop loss at 222, which is the lower edge of this small box. The reasoning is straightforward: during a policy vacuum, funding rates are neutral, OI is stable, and the price has priced in sixty percent of the bad news; the remaining forty percent doesnโ€™t matter whether it materializes or not, as my position is small enough to handle. If it breaks below 222 and OI drops sharply, then I wonโ€™t hesitate to remove it from my watchlist and consider below 200 instead. Itโ€™s better to wait for the structure to reveal itself than to guess the direction now. This round of decline resonates with the overall weakness of the tech sector; the Nasdaq got hammered last night, but QCOM took an extra hit. The old dog took a look: on $QCOM , it dropped 7.588%, price stuck at 231.63, with an open interest of 38,216 contracts, which isn't too shabby, but the funding rate is flat at 0.00000000, not a shred left. The bulls and bears aren't exchanging cash, indicating neither side dares to make a move. No one in the market genuinely believes it can bounce back immediately, and the shorts don't have the guts to push it down further. This stagnant funding rate reminds me of what I've seen numerous times in the semiconductor chain's perpetuals; often, itโ€™s not the trend's end, but both sides getting spooked. When peers pop up, it becomes quite interesting. Over at NVDA, they're fighting tooth and nail for computing power, AMD is riding the MI300 wave with the data center narrative, and MU is turning things around thanks to the storage cycle; each has AI backing. $QCOM looks like an outsider, holding onto its mobile chip legacy, and the market thinks, since you aren't selling GPUs, how much does AI really relate to you? But the old dog has to say, in the past two years, a large portion of edge AI and on-device inference runs on the Snapdragon platform, and not many have seriously calculated QCOM's inference chip shipment volume. This drop feels more like being squeezed out of the semiconductor AI rotation, rather than a fundamental collapse. The on-chain perp's open interest structure also reveals hints; recently, those reducing positions are mostly short-term speculative accounts, while the concentration of holdings has actually increased, and several established market makers' wallets havenโ€™t moved much. Cycle positions need to be revisited too. The semiconductor sector usually sees an end to inventory destocking in the fourth quarter, and QCOMโ€™s channel inventory on the mobile side is already low. Previous operating data pointed towards a shipping rebound. From what I remember, the last time there was a long-term funding rate near zero combined with such a massive daily bearish candlestick occurred during last year's third-quarter adjustment, after which it leisurely bounced back around 18% over the next two months. Although it wasn't a massive surge, it was enough to make those who got caught at the bottom back then curse. The current environment feels somewhat similar: interest rate expectations are wavering, capital is flowing from high-risk hardware into defensive sectors, and QCOM is just being seen as a cash cow. The market says it's broken, there's no saving it, but I actually think this is the most undervalued on-device player in the AI chain; the consensus is off here. As for specific moves, Iโ€™ll be watching the 225 mark. If the weekly close canโ€™t hold 225, Iโ€™ll cut my light position without hesitation, no holding onto a losing trade. $QCOM took a quick hit of 5.5%, pushing the price down to around 237. The sell pressure isn't heavy, but the order book is thin. The old dog took a glance at the funding rate and it went straight to zero; neither the longs nor the shorts are willing to pay interest, which is rare in perpetual contracts. Typically, during a big drop, the funding rate turns negative, with shorts paying longs, indicating someone is trying to catch a rebound, but this time it wasnโ€™t the caseโ€”funding feels as cold as if it's been switched off. Open Interest (OI) is steady at 36,600 contracts, with no major liquidation cascade; it looks more like holders are actively unwinding leverage rather than being forcefully liquidated. This drop has no earnings report catalyst, nor any breaking news; itโ€™s purely a structure that the market itself has formed. The semiconductor sector is generally soft, but $QCOM has become the weakest on a single-day basis. The holdings of the top few dozen wallets barely budged during the afternoon plungeโ€”thereโ€™s still inventory, just that market makers and arbitrage funds are pulling liquidity. The funding rate hitting zero, combined with a notable drop, often means that short-term sentiment has cleared out a bit. To push down further, we need a fresh batch of active sell orders, not just the current passive reduction. The last time we saw a similar situation was during last monthโ€™s approximately 5% pullback, where the rate also dropped to zero, and it took three days of consolidation before a direction emerged. If action is to be taken, the old dog will keep an eye on the 235 line. The 233-235 range is where the price was caught multiple times last month. If it breaks through again and the spot doesnโ€™t bounce back, I wonโ€™t hesitate to liquidate and take the loss. Conversely, if it can hold above 240 this week and the funding rate slightly turns positive again, it indicates that some capital is willing to pay interest to go long, which would be worth taking a small position to test the waters. The general sentiment in the market suggests that semiconductors wonโ€™t see action until year-end; Iโ€™m not as pessimistic, thoughโ€”the third quarter order data hasnโ€™t fully reflected yet, and this valuation drop seems a bit overdone. However, Iโ€™m not bold enough to go in heavy; at most, Iโ€™ll take a half position as a base. If Iโ€™m wrong, Iโ€™ll use 235 as a stop-loss for protection. The old dog hesitated around 200 last year under similar circumstances, when the funding rate was flat. It later rallied, and I realized I had been shaken out. This time, Iโ€™m neither chasing shorts nor rushing to buy; Iโ€™ll keep half my ammo on the sidelines to watch, which is better than getting slapped from both sides.
